WARNING

Turn the electrical power off at the electrical panel
board (circuit breaker or fuse box) and lock or tag
the panel board door to prevent someone from
turning on power while you are working on the
heater. Failure to do so could result in serious
electrical shock, burns, or possible death.

1. Read all instructions before using this heater.

2. Read all information labels. Verify that the electrical

supply wires are the same voltage as the heater.

3. All electrical work and materials must comply with the

National Electric Code (NEC), the Occupational Safety
and Health Act (OSHA), and all state and local codes.

4. Connect the grounding screw provided in the wall can to

the supply ground wire.

5. If you need to install a new circuit or need additional

wiring information, consult a qualified electrician.

6. Protect electrical supply from kinks, sharp objects, oil,

grease, hot surfaces or chemicals.

7.

WARNING

Overheating or fire may occur. DO NOT install the heater
in a floor, in the ceiling, below a towel bar, behind a door, or
anywhere the air discharge may be blocked in any manner.

8.

WARNING

Fire or explosion may occur. DO NOT install heater in any
area where combustible vapors, gases, liquids, or excessive
lint or dust are present.

9.

WARNING

DO NOT install where heater is likely to get wet.

10.

WARNING

Heater must be connected to a GFCI protected branch circuit.

11.

WARNING

Burn Hazard. This heater is hot when in use. To avoid burns,
do not let bare skin touch hot surfaces. Use extreme caution
when any heater is used by or near children or invalids.

12.

WARNING

Risk of Electrical Shock. DO NOT install the heater directly
above bathtub or sink. DO NOT install in shower stall area
(Manufacturer recommends a minimum 2 foot clearance).

13.

WARNING

Risk of Electrical Shock. Connect grounding lead to grounding
screw provided. Keep all foreign objects out of heater.

14.

WARNING

Risk of Electrical Shock. Never place a switch where it can
be reached from the tub or shower enclosure.

15.

WARNING

Risk of Fire. Do not block heater. Heater must be kept clear
of all obstructions: a minimum of 3 feet in front, 6 inches

above and on both sides. Heater must be kept clean of lint,
dirt and debris. (See Maintenance Instructions.)

Features & Benefits

Thermal safeguard

High temperature manual reset:
turns off heater if normal operating
temperatures are exceeded

Commercial grade steel element - painted to resist rusting

Built-in controls
- Single pole thermostat with disabled (no heat) position
- 60 minute timer overrides thermostat for instant warmth

Powder coat paint process eliminates sharp cutting edges

Three year extended warranty on element and motor

Factory tested

Multi-Volt configurations
120 or 240 Volt AC (1000 Watts)
*Factory set at 240-Volts
